    Biking in California

    Bike rental in Los Angeles

    California is notorious for its traffic. Due to the never-ending congestion, many people have taken up cycling as a quicker way to get around, while also getting in their daily exercise. 

    In fact, California has some great bike paths that take riders past various noteworthy attractions and locales. 

    The Marvin Braude Bike Trail, more well-known as the Strand, is a 22-mile path that takes you along Los Angeles’ beaches. Along the way, you can stop at Dogtown Coffee in Santa Monica, get some drinks from the Venice Ale House, and get something to eat at the Surf Food Stand in Manhattan Beach. 

    However, you run into some issues once you stray off these designated bike paths. 

    Bicycle Accident Statistics Across California

    By the beginning of 2020, California bike fatalities hit a 25-year high. Between 2016 and 2018, the accident rate was at the highest for any three-year period in the state. In that three-year span, 455 cyclists died in traffic accidents. 

    With new bike-sharing programs popping up all over the country, more people than ever before are using cycling as a main mode of transportation. However, many cities have yet to adjust to this increase, failing to implement bike safety plans.

    In fact, not many Southern CA roads have been optimized for bike safety. This is despite the fact that bicyclists share the roads with moving vehicles. Related data shows that:

    • Majority of cyclists involved in these accidents were 20 years of age and older
    • Fatalities among bicyclists younger than 20 have decreased by 90% since 1975
    • Deaths amount bike-riders 20 years and older have tripled

    These bicycle accident stats show a need for new bicycle safety laws to protect California’s citizens. 

    Bicycle Accident Statistics in Los Angeles

    For at least a few years now, LA has been considered one of the worst bike cities in the U.S. Although the weather provides a comfortable riding experience, there are many road hazards cyclists must face, including:

    • Distracted drivers 
    • Poor road conditions 
    • Lack of designated bike lanes

    According to the Federal Highway Administration, nearly half of all metropolitan areas in California are viewed as having the worst road conditions. 

    In 2020, there were ten fatalities in Los Angeles and 1,369 reported bicycle injuries. Across the entire county, those numbers rose to 23 deaths and over 2,500 accidents. In 2019, it saw over double the number of collisions compared to Historic South Central, which came in second according to Crosstown. 

    Additionally, most bicyclists in L.A. don’t wear helmets. Failure to use a helmet greatly increases your risk of death in the case of an accident. 

    Factors in Bicycle Accidents

    Different factors result in more bicycle deaths in certain places, like downtown cities. This is attributed to various factors.

    First, bicycle lanes are meant to protect cyclists on heavily trafficked roads. However, this does not always happen. Depending on the city or county, it’s sometimes illegal to ride on the sidewalk with pedestrians. If a bike lane is not available, then the bicyclist must ride alongside motor vehicles, like cars and large trucks.

    Therefore, bicyclists face many of the same risks as motorcyclists. For example, speeding vehicles can dangerously cut bike riders off. This is why it’s important to learn the specific traffic laws when it comes to riding. It also helps to be familiar with the roads and avoid areas that are known to be particularly hazardous.

    Also, the condition of the road heavily impacts the safety of bicyclists. If the road isn’t well-maintained, then the gravel can interfere with the bike’s movement capabilities and mechanics. Or, a vehicle may also swerve to avoid a pothole and run into a cyclist. 

    Bicycle Safety Measures

    In order to stay safe on the road, there are a few measures to take that will protect you and avoid an accident. 

    Protective gear is one of the simplest ways to maintain road safety. A fitted bike helmet protects your head from a collision. Also, reflective gear and bright clothing increase visibility to drivers. Similarly, putting reflectors on your bike also accomplishes this.

    Ride defensively and predictably. Utilizing hand gestures to signal and let neighboring vehicles know when turning goes a long way. If you need to use the sidewalk, make sure to watch for pedestrians and announce when you’re approaching and about to pass by.
